Calik Enerji has commenced construction of a 1,250MW natural-gas-fired generating plant in Karbala, Iraq.

The $445m Al-Khairat power station will be equipped with ten gas turbines of 250MW each, which form a part of the 56 gas turbines purchased by the Iraqi Government from GE.

Construction is expected to be completed within 24 months, reports Reuters.

The company has also secured a contract for the construction of a 750MW gas fired plant worth $388.5m in the northern Iraqi city of Mosul.
